Consider the profound impact on key endocrine regulators. Growth hormone, a powerful agent in tissue repair and lean mass development, experiences its most significant pulsatile release during slow-wave sleep. Testosterone levels, vital for muscle protein synthesis and metabolic health, exhibit a direct correlation with sleep duration and quality. When sleep becomes a performance blocker, these essential hormonal signals weaken, impeding your body’s ability to recover, adapt, and build robust structures.

Your physique’s ultimate expression, its strength, density, and aesthetic contour, originates from a well-orchestrated internal chemistry. Without adequate sleep, your body battles a state of elevated cortisol, a catabolic hormone that breaks down tissue and interferes with anabolism. Inflammation also rises, impeding recovery and increasing susceptibility to injury. Deep Tissue Reparation

Muscle protein synthesis, the fundamental process by which your body builds new muscle fibers, receives a significant boost during sleep. This is when amino acids are most efficiently incorporated into muscle tissue, directly rebuilding and reinforcing structures stressed by training. A dedicated period of undisturbed sleep permits your body’s cellular architects to perform their crucial work without interruption.

Furthermore, glycogen stores, the primary fuel source for high-intensity exercise, undergo significant replenishment overnight. Depleted glycogen diminishes performance in subsequent workouts. Adequate sleep ensures your muscular energy reserves are fully restored, priming you for the next demanding session.

Hormonal Orchestration for Anabolism

The intricate dance of anabolic hormones reaches its crescendo during the deepest stages of sleep. Human Growth Hormone (HGH) release, primarily pulsatile, peaks during slow-wave sleep. This powerful peptide directly stimulates protein synthesis, mobilizes fat for energy, and promotes tissue repair, making it indispensable for lean mass accrual. Optimizing your sleep directly augments this natural, potent endocrine signal.

Testosterone production also follows a circadian rhythm, reaching its highest concentrations in the morning following a night of quality sleep. This vital androgen impacts muscle mass, strength, bone density, and overall vitality. Chronic sleep curtailment significantly suppresses testosterone levels, hindering your muscle-building efforts and overall performance.

Conversely, cortisol, a catabolic stress hormone, typically decreases during sleep. Insufficient rest elevates cortisol, promoting protein breakdown and fat storage while suppressing the anabolic environment. Regulating cortisol through consistent, high-quality sleep preserves your hard-earned muscle and accelerates recovery.

Strategic Sleep Optimization

Implementing a structured sleep protocol transforms this vital biological function into a quantifiable advantage. Precise adjustments to your environment and routine can significantly enhance the depth and restorative power of your sleep cycles.

  • Circadian Rhythm Synchronization: Expose yourself to bright, natural light immediately upon waking to set your internal clock. Limit blue light exposure from screens in the hours before bedtime, signaling your body to initiate melatonin production. Consistency in wake-up and sleep times, even on weekends, reinforces this rhythm.
  • Environmental Calibration: Transform your bedroom into a sanctuary optimized for rest. Maintain a cool ambient temperature, typically between 60-67 degrees Fahrenheit. Ensure complete darkness, blocking out all external light sources. Minimize noise with earplugs or a white noise machine to prevent sleep disruptions.
  • Pre-Sleep Decompression Protocols: Develop a consistent evening routine that signals your body it is time to wind down. This could involve reading a physical book, taking a warm bath, engaging in light stretching, or meditation. Avoid mentally stimulating activities, heavy meals, excessive liquids, or intense exercise too close to bedtime.
  • Nutrient Timing and Supplementation: Consider the timing of your last meal. A protein-rich snack a few hours before bed can provide sustained amino acids for nocturnal muscle repair. Certain compounds, like magnesium or apigenin, can support sleep quality for some individuals, though these should always be integrated thoughtfully into a comprehensive regimen.
  • Performance Metric Tracking: Utilize wearable technology or sleep tracking applications to monitor your sleep patterns. This data provides objective insights into sleep duration, efficiency, and the time spent in different sleep stages, allowing for informed adjustments to your optimization strategies. Observing trends in your deep sleep and REM sleep offers powerful feedback.
